Morbidity and mortality rates in major blunt trauma to the upper chest.

G V Poole, R T Myers.   

Abstract

It is widely believed that fractures of the first rib are associated with more severe injuries than fractures of other ribs. To confirm or refute that belief, we conducted a retrospective review of 168 patients with major blunt trauma resulting in fractures of the upper ribs treated at the North Carolina Baptist Hospital. A comparison of morbidity and mortality rates in relation to highest rib fractured showed essentially no correlation. We concluded that all patients with deceleration or crushing injuries involving upper-rib fractures must be suspected of having significant multiple organ system trauma and evaluated accordingly.
